Abstract

We propose goodness-of-fit tests for Birnbaum-Saunders distributions with type-II right censored data. Classical goodness-of-fit tests based on the empirical distribution, such as Anderson-Darling, Cramér-von Misses, and Kolmogorov-Smirnov, are adapted to censored data, and evaluated by means of a simulation study. The obtained results are applied to real-world censored reliability data.
